Solar panel rep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ues that can impair the performance of an existing solar energy system. Technicians assess the condition of panels, wiring, inverters, and other components to identify faults such as physical damage, electrical failures, or connection problems. Repairs may include replacing damaged panels, repairing or replacing inverters, fixing wiring issues, or addressing shading and dirt accumulation that hinder efficiency. The goal is to restore the system’s optimal functionality, ensuring it continues to produce energy effectively.
These services help resolve common problems that can reduce the energy output of a solar installation. Over time, panels may develop cracks, discoloration, or other physical damages from weather or debris. Electrical components like inverters can malfunction or degrade, leading to reduced power conversion. Wiring issues, such as corrosion or loose connections, can cause system interruptions or safety concerns. Repair services address these issues to improve system reliability, prevent further damage, and extend the lifespan of the solar setup.

The overview below groups typical Solar Panel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sussex County,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Replacement Costs - Replacing a damaged solar panel typically costs between $200 and $1,000 per panel, depending on size and type. Larger or higher-efficiency panels tend to be more expensive.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ific panel models.
Repair Service Fees - Repair costs for solar panels usually range from $150 to $500 per incident, covering issues like wiring or inverter problems. The exact price depends on the complexity of the repair needed.
Inspection and Diagnostic Fees - Many service providers charge between $100 and $300 for inspection and diagnostics to identify issues. This fee may be credited toward repair costs if work is authorized.
Maintenance and Preventive Checks - Routine maintenance or preventive checks generally cost between $100 and $250. These services help identify potential problems before they develop into costly repairs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
